NCT's Taeyong second mini album entitled ' TAP ', which was released on February 26, 2024, received praise and positive reviews from the well-known British music media, NME. Quoting from Naver on Monday March 4, 2024, NME released a review article for Taeyong's second mini album 'TAP' which was released on March 1, 2024 local time. 

In an article entitled 'Taeyong Proves He's More Than Just Unique Through 'TAP', NME said that the idol born in 1995 was never afraid to explore his unique charm. In the ten years of his career, NME has seen Taeyong's original side not only through the release of solo songs, but also the songs he released with his group members. 

Especially for the release of 'TAP', NME said Taeyong dared to break away from existing methods and show more different sides and styles. "The main song 'TAP' is a song that shows Taeyong's humorous side, with a light and cheerful atmosphere, making this song enjoyable to listen to," wrote NME. They added, “This latest album also presents a deeper side of Taeyong's abilities as a singer. 

This is a good album, taking advantage of the charm of Taeyong's deep and husky vocal tone.” NME also praised Taeyong for always doing his best and expanding his limits. As in the song 'Loading 404' is one of the best examples of Taeyong's musical growth and ability as a solo singer. It is one of his best songs according to NME. 

NME reviewed it in more depth, and said that Taeyong was not only able to convey the unique side of himself honestly. However, he also dared to express his inner concerns. “He has the ability to elicit empathy from his listeners. 'TAP' is a song that is able to understand a person's complicated emotions and bring out empathy in them. 

"This is a masterclass of songs at its best," explained NME. Meanwhile, NCT's Taeyong second mini album 'TAP' consists of 6 songs including the main song with the same title. Taeyong directly participated in the song composition and wrote all the lyrics of the songs on the album himself.
